Subject: Incremental static rebuilds now default on Pinefold

Team, starting with tonight's release, the Pinefold site generator will use incremental rebuilds by default. Only pages whose content hashes changed get regenerated, which cut our full publish time from eleven minutes to under ninety seconds on the Westharrow docs tree. If you see stale pages, clear the fragment cache and re-run the publish step before filing anything. Future maintainers: the rollback flag lives in the deploy config. Each release is stamped with the token below.

pipeline stamp: htk31_f769b577b3028a4e9958e5bb8d1259a

TURN-208: Gatevale turnstile counters at the Merrow Field pilot double-count when a rotation reverses mid-cycle. Attendance totals drift roughly 2% high per event. The debounce window fix is implemented, reviewed by Ilsa, and soak-tested across two simulated match days without drift. Ready for your cut; the candidate build is identified below.

trace token, tagag-tafog: htk6_5ed18c

## Support

Rendergrove handles all transcode jobs for the Pelton cluster. Before filing anything: check the farm dashboard, confirm the job isn't queued behind a 4K batch, and grab the worker logs from the last hour. Restarting a stuck worker is safe; restarting the scheduler is not — that needs two approvals. Known codec issues are tracked on the Rendergrove wiki. Escalations outside business hours go through the duty rotation. For everything else, reach the farm operators here.

escalation mailbox, bafog-fafog: ulador@paliqlabs.internal